ESGL Holdings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2024FY 2023FY 2022FY 2021FY 2020
Period EndingD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Valuation Ratios
P/S Ratio8.771.4222.02
P/B Ratio3.641.108.67
Price/Tangible Book4.561.5610.09
Price/FCF1.9177.57
Price/OCF1.6757.77
Enterprise Value Ratios
EV/Revenue9.802.5623.26
EV/EBITDA116.39364.36424.71
EV/FCF3.4481.91
Profitability & Returns
Return on Equity (ROE)-0.06%-8.98%-0.25%-0.12%
Return on Assets (ROA)-0.02%-0.03%-0.03%-0.02%
Return on Capital Employed (ROCE)-0.05%-0.12%-0.07%-0.08%-0.17%
Leverage & Solvency Ratios
Debt/Equity0.440.990.611.451.58
Debt/EBITDA8.2226.4016.079.08250.19
Debt/FCF1.725.494.68
Liquidity Ratios
Current Ratio0.230.100.130.130.12
Quick Ratio0.160.060.070.050.06
Efficiency Ratios
Asset Turnover0.240.240.240.24
Inventory Turnover5.1818.033.442.17
Yield & Distribution Ratios
Earnings Yield-0.01%-10.76%-0.02%
FCF Yield-0.06%0.52%0.01%
Buyback Yield-3.03%-0.01%